WitrynaAntilogarithm is the opposite of logarithms. To find number whole logarithm is given. It is possible to use logarithm table in reverse. However, it’s convenient to use the tables of antilogarithms. When finding an antilogarithm, look up the fractional part only, then used the integer to place correct the decimal point correctly in the final ... Note that … is it bad to wake and bakeWitrynaExponentials and logarithms are inverse functions of each other. They use the same information but solve for different variables. Exponential (indices) functions are used to solve when a constant is raised to an exponent (power), whilst a logarithm solves to find the exponent.
